SANTA CLARA — As the rain drizzled down on Thursday in Santa Clara and the 49ers gathered in their typical pre-practice huddle, one player took off his helmet and began to address his assembled teammates, readying them for the team’s longest practice of the week. The identity of said player was obstructed by towering linemen as they gathered to hear his message. Not too much later, a single hand went up into the air, joined by those of his teammates. Then the group dispersed, revealing Chase Lucas putting his helmet back on.“I got to say what I need to say to my boys, and getting them juiced and ready to roll,” Lucas told NBC Sports Bay Area. “I feel like everybody says I always know what to say, but I’m just speaking from the heart. Whatever comes to my head, if it makes sense.”On Thursday, Lucas was urged by George Kittle to break down the huddle.
